Why Mac? |
|
A:
|
Today's teachers demand creativity. The types of projects you will find yourself doing as an education student include video editing, photo editing, web authoring, podcast recording and more. We feel the integrated iLife Suite, bundled with the Mac laptop provide the best and easiest means for producing these creative types of projects. In addition, the security of the Mac OS is superior. Less time dealing with viruses and spyware means more time being productive in the classroom. |

Can I run Windows on a Mac? |
|
A:
|
Yes. By running
Boot Camp on your Mac, you can install and run Windows. It's like having two machines in one! |

Will this laptop be enough for all 4 years of college? |
|
A:
|
There's a familiar saying, "You can never have enough memory (or hard drive space)." The models recommended should be enough to get you through your college career, however as your skills develop, you may find it necessary at some point to increase your RAM or hard drive space. The good thing is all of the recommended models allow you to do this very easily. |
